Typical HVAC Emergencies That Require Immediate Attention

A number of HVAC problems call for emergency service. Recognizing these issues can help you understand when to require professional help:

  • Complete System Failure
    When your heating or cooling system quits working totally, specifically throughout severe weather, it's more than just an hassle-- it can be unsafe. Our emergency HVAC professionals can detect and repair the issue quickly, restoring your home's comfort and security.
  • Unusual Noises or Smells
    Strange sounds like banging, grinding, or shrieking from your HVAC system typically signify a serious mechanical problem that might lead to bigger problems if not addressed quickly. Similarly, uncommon smells may suggest electrical problems and even gas leakages. Our expert HVAC specialists can identify these problems and make necessary repairs before they end up being unsafe.
  • Water Leaks
    Water dripping from your HVAC system can harm your home and lead to mold growth. Our contractors find the source of leakages and repair them properly to prevent water damage.
  • Refrigerant Leaks
    Refrigerant leakages minimize your air conditioning unit's cooling capability and can damage the environment. They need professional attention as refrigerant dealing with require specialized training and equipment.
  • Electrical Issues
    Problems with electrical parts in your HVAC system position fire dangers and must be resolved right away by certified specialists. Our HVAC specialists have the training to safely fix electrical issues.

Common HVAC Problems Homeowners Face

  • Poor Airflow
    Limited air flow makes your system work more difficult and decreases convenience. Our HVAC specialists identify airflow issues, whether caused by duct problems, unclean filters, or fan issues.
  • Uneven Heating or Cooling
    If some rooms are too hot while others are too cold, you may have duct problems, insulation problems, or an incorrectly sized system. Our expert HVAC specialists can diagnose these issues and advise services.
  • Short Cycling
    When your system switches on and off regularly, it wastes energy and wears out components much faster. Our HVAC professionals can figure out whether the issue comes from a clogged filter, inappropriate thermostat settings, or something more serious.
  • High Energy Bills
    Unexpected boosts in energy costs frequently show HVAC inefficiency. Our contractors perform energy efficiency evaluations to identify the cause and suggest enhancements.
  • Humidity Problems
    Modern HVAC systems must assist control indoor humidity. If your home feels too humid in summer or too dry in winter, our HVAC professionals can suggest solutions to improve comfort and air quality.
  • Thermostat Problems
    Often what seems like a system failure is really a thermostat problem. Our HVAC contractors can repair or change thermostats and help you upgrade to programmable or clever models for better comfort control and energy cost savings.

Preparing for HVAC Emergencies

  • Keep Contact Information Handy
    Store our emergency number 888-409-7841 in your phone so you can reach us quickly when required.
  • Know Your System Basics
    Acquaint yourself with the place of your HVAC equipment and how to shut it off in case of emergency.
  • Perform Regular Maintenance
    Regular expert maintenance reduces the probability of emergency situations. Our HVAC professionals can develop a maintenance schedule for your system.
  • Set Up Carbon Monoxide Detectors
    If you have combustion heating equipment, carbon monoxide detectors provide an early caution of harmful leakages.
